A mixture of 2-(6-fluoro-1-methyl-1H-indazol-3-yl)-5H-pyrrolo[3,2-b]pyrazine-7-carboxylic acid (90 mg, 0.29 mmol), 1-aminocyclopropanecarbonitrile hydrochloride (41 mg, 0.348 mmol), EDCI (110 mg, 0.58 mmol) and DMAP (75 mg, 0.58 mmol) in DMF (5 mL) was stirred at room temperature for 16 hours. Then the mixture was poured into water (5 mL) and filtered to give the crude product which was purified by preparative-HPLC (Gemini 5u C18 150×21.2 mm; inject volume: 3 mL/inj, flow rate: 20 mL/min; wavelength: 214 nm and 254 nm; the gradient conditions were: 40% acetonitrile/60% water (0.1% trifluoroacetic acid, v/v) initially, proceeding to 55% acetonitrile/45% water (0.1% trifluoroacetic acid, v/v) in a linear fashion over 9 min.) to give N-(1-cyanocyclopropyl)-2-(6-fluoro-1-methyl-1H-indazol-3-yl)-5H-pyrrolo[3,2-b]pyrazine-7-carboxamide (25 mg, 23%) as a white solid. MS: (M+H)+=376; 1H NMR (300 MHz, DMSO): δ 12.95 (s, 1H), 9.10 (s, 1H), 8.87 (s, 1H), 8.56-8.53 (m, 2H), 6.69 (d, 1H, J=8.7 Hz), 7.26 (t, 1H, J=8.7 Hz), 4.15 (s, 3H), 1.70 (brs, 2H), 1.64 (brs, 2H).
